In the world of manufacturing and engineering, precision is paramount. One of the essential tools that facilitate this precision is the disc gauge. A disc gauge is a measuring instrument used to determine the thickness of various materials. It typically consists of a circular disc with calibrated markings that allow users to measure dimensions accurately. This tool is particularly useful in industries where material thickness can significantly affect the quality and performance of the final product.The disc gauge serves multiple purposes across various sectors. For instance, in the metalworking industry, it is crucial for ensuring that metal sheets meet specific thickness requirements. If the thickness is not within the desired range, it can lead to structural failures or inefficiencies in the manufacturing process. Similarly, in the woodworking sector, a disc gauge can help carpenters and woodworkers achieve precise cuts and joints, which are vital for the integrity of furniture and other wooden structures.Moreover, the disc gauge is not limited to industrial applications; it also finds its place in laboratories and research settings. Scientists often need to measure the thickness of samples accurately, whether they are studying biological tissues or material properties. The disc gauge provides a straightforward and reliable method for such measurements, allowing researchers to focus on their experiments without worrying about measurement inaccuracies.One of the key advantages of using a disc gauge is its simplicity and ease of use. Unlike more complex measuring instruments, which may require extensive training or specialized knowledge, a disc gauge can be utilized by anyone with basic understanding. Users simply align the gauge with the edge of the material and read the measurement directly from the calibrated markings. This user-friendly design makes it an indispensable tool in both professional and educational settings.In addition to its practical applications, the disc gauge also embodies the principles of good design and engineering. Its circular shape allows for a more uniform distribution of pressure when measuring materials, which enhances accuracy. Furthermore, the durability of materials used in making disc gauges, such as stainless steel or high-grade plastics, ensures that they can withstand the rigors of daily use without compromising their measuring capabilities.As technology continues to advance, digital versions of the disc gauge have emerged, offering even greater precision and ease of use. These digital gauges can provide instant readings and often come equipped with additional features, such as data logging and connectivity options for integration with computer systems. However, despite the rise of digital tools, the traditional disc gauge remains popular due to its reliability, affordability, and the tactile experience it offers users.In conclusion, the disc gauge is an essential tool in various fields, providing accurate measurements that are critical for quality control and product integrity. Its simple design, versatility, and effectiveness make it a favorite among professionals and hobbyists alike. As industries continue to evolve, the disc gauge will undoubtedly remain a cornerstone of precision measurement, showcasing the importance of accuracy in our increasingly complex world.
